Mr. Hugh Jenkins
asked the Secretary of State for Education and Science what progress she is making in persuading the Arts Council to become more democratic and representative of workers in the arts and entertainment.
Mrs. Shirley Williams
In making appointments to the Arts Council I shall bear in mind the need to reflect the interests of those who work in the arts and entertainments field, but also the need to represent the interests of the wider public who support the arts directly and through taxation.
